    I think Ferrari has also approved Quaker State synthetic where previously only Helix was approved. It's probably not a good idea to add Quaker State if you are currently using Helix, but if you are doing a full oil change, then Quaker State should be easier to locate going forward (Quaker State oils are available at Autozone, Pep Boys, etc -- although Quaker State has a lot of different synthetics and it wasn't obvious to me which one is approved by Ferrari).
